SPEEDWAY: Bay rider scores win

Hawke's Bay solobike rider Andrew Bargh collected a first, two seconds and a third at his first meeting in England this week.
Bargh, 18, is contracted to Wimbledon, where former world champions Ronnie Moore and Barry Briggs rode. He is the NZ under-21 champion, the North Island champion and also the
Manawatu champion.
The brother of Bay TQ driver, Christine Bargh, he is contracted to Palmerston North during the summer because solos don't race regularly at Meeanee. He is boarding with English rider Jason Bunyon, who won this summer's international series in New Zealand, including a Meeanee round.
